flowable sql
什么是.flowable sql.
.flowable sql.是流程引擎Flowable中使用的关系型数据库。它支持多种类型的数据库,例如MySQL、PostgreSQL以及Oracle等。.flowable sql.使用了Hibernate框架进行ORM映射,可以方便地将Java对象映射成数据库中的记录。
.flowable sql.的优点
.flowable sql.具有许多优点。首先,它支持事务和锁,可以确保数据的一致性和并发安全性。其次,.flowable sql.使用Hibernate作为ORM框架,可以使开发者更加方便地编写Java代码。同时,使用Hibernate还可以缩短数据库开发的时间和减少出错。最后,.flowable sql.是流程引擎Flowable中所使用的关系型数据库,可以与流程引擎无缝对接,提高开发效率。
如何使用.flowable sql.
要使用.flowable sql.,需要在项目的依赖中添加相关的Jar包。例如,如果要使用MySQL数据库,则需要添加mysql-connector-java依赖。然后,在配置文件中进行数据库连接的配置。最后,在Java代码中使用SessionFactory获取Session对象,即可对数据进行增删改查等操作。
.flowable sql.的应用场景
.flowable sql.主要应用于Flowable工作流领域。Flowable是一个轻量级的工作流引擎,主要用于业务流程的自动化处理。在业务场景中,需要将流程数据存储到数据库中进行管理。.flowable sql.作为Flowable所使用的数据库,可以为业务流程提供高效、可靠的数据管理。
.flowable sql.的局限性
.flowable sql.虽然具有许多优点,但也有一些局限性。首先,由于其是关系型数据库,存在表与表之间的关系。因此,在处理一些复杂的数据结构时,可能会出现性能瓶颈。其次,.flowable sql.的使用需要一定的技术门槛,需要开发者具备一定的数据库知识、Java编程能力等。最后,.flowable sql.虽然支持多种类型的数据库,但是在不同的数据库上的性能表现可能存在差异。